How Suggest Actually Works

At its core, a suggest is a lightweight prompt designed to guide choice without taking over the experience. Systems gather anonymous patterns, such as topics or tools users engage with most often, to shape each suggest. Based on that data, algorithms generate a suggest that fits the context, like recommending a reading topic during a commute. This process happens quickly, so the user sees a brief suggest instead of a long list of options. The goal is to reduce friction while still leaving full control in the user’s hands.

From a technical perspective, suggest mechanisms rely on clear rules and adjustable parameters. Engineers test different timing, phrasing, and placement to ensure the suggest feels helpful rather than distracting. For example, a productivity app might offer a suggest to try a new template only after a user completes a similar task twice. In another case, a news reader could receive a suggest to follow a specific category based on recent taps. Over time, feedback loops help refine how and when a suggest appears for each person.
